Mukund Thakur created YARN-11712:
------------------------------------

             Summary: Yarn-ui build fails in ARM docker looking for python2.
                 Key: YARN-11712
                 URL: https://issues.apache.org/jira/browse/YARN-11712
             Project: Hadoop YARN
          Issue Type: Bug
          Components: yarn-ui-v2
    Affects Versions: 3.4.0
            Reporter: Mukund Thakur


{noformat}
INFO] Exit code: 1
[INFO] Command: node install.js
[INFO] Arguments: 
[INFO] Directory: 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/phantomjs-prebuilt
[INFO] Output:
[INFO] PhantomJS not found on PATH
[INFO] Unexpected platform or architecture: linux/arm64
[INFO] It seems there is no binary available for your platform/architecture
[INFO] Try to install PhantomJS globally"
[INFO] error 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ass:
 Command failed.
[INFO] error 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ass:
 Command failed.info Visit https://yarnpkg.com/en/docs/cli/install for 
documentation about this command.
[INFO] Exit code: 1
[INFO] Command: node scripts/build.js
[INFO] Arguments: 
[INFO] Directory: 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ass
[INFO] Output:
[INFO] Building: 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node/node
 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ass/node_modules/node-gyp/bin/node-gyp.js
 rebuild --verbose --libsass_ext= --libsass_cflags= --libsass_ldflags= 
--libsass_library=
[INFO] gyp info it worked if it ends with ok
[INFO] gyp verb cli [
[INFO] gyp verb cli   
'/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node/node',
[INFO] gyp verb cli   
'/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ass/node_modules/node-gyp/bin/node-gyp.js',
[INFO] gyp verb cli   'rebuild',
[INFO] gyp verb cli   '--verbose',
[INFO] gyp verb cli   '--libsass_ext=',
[INFO] gyp verb cli   '--libsass_cflags=',
[INFO] gyp verb cli   '--libsass_ldflags=',
[INFO] gyp verb cli   '--libsass_library='
[INFO] gyp verb cli ]
[INFO] gyp info using node-gyp@3.8.0
[INFO] gyp info using node@12.22.1 | linux | arm64
[INFO] gyp verb command rebuild []
[INFO] gyp verb command clean []
[INFO] gyp verb clean removing "build" directory
[INFO] gyp verb command configure []
[INFO] gyp verb check python checking for Python executable "python2" in the 
PATH
[INFO] gyp verb `which` failed Error: not found: python2
[INFO] gyp verb `which` failed     at getNotFoundError 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:13:12)
[INFO] gyp verb `which` failed     at F 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:68:19)
[INFO] gyp verb `which` failed     at E 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:80:29)
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:89:16
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/index.js:42:5
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/mode.js:8:5
[INFO] gyp verb `which` failed     at FSReqCallback.oncomplete (fs.js:168:21)
[INFO] gyp verb `which` failed  python2 Error: not found: python2
[INFO] gyp verb `which` failed     at getNotFoundError 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:13:12)
[INFO] gyp verb `which` failed     at F 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:68:19)
[INFO] gyp verb `which` failed     at E 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:80:29)
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:89:16
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/index.js:42:5
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/mode.js:8:5
[INFO] gyp verb `which` failed     at FSReqCallback.oncomplete (fs.js:168:21) {
[INFO] gyp verb `which` failed   code: 'ENOENT'
[INFO] gyp verb `which` failed }
[INFO] gyp verb check python checking for Python executable "python" in the PATH
[INFO] gyp verb `which` failed Error: not found: python
[INFO] gyp verb `which` failed     at getNotFoundError 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:13:12)
[INFO] gyp verb `which` failed     at F 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:68:19)
[INFO] gyp verb `which` failed     at E 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:80:29)
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:89:16
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/index.js:42:5
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/mode.js:8:5
[INFO] gyp verb `which` failed     at FSReqCallback.oncomplete (fs.js:168:21)
[INFO] gyp verb `which` failed  python Error: not found: python
[INFO] gyp verb `which` failed     at getNotFoundError 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:13:12)
[INFO] gyp verb `which` failed     at F 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:68:19)
[INFO] gyp verb `which` failed     at E 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:80:29)
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:89:16
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/index.js:42:5
[INFO] gyp verb `which` failed     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/mode.js:8:5
[INFO] gyp verb `which` failed     at FSReqCallback.oncomplete (fs.js:168:21) {
[INFO] gyp verb `which` failed   code: 'ENOENT'
[INFO] gyp verb `which` failed }
[INFO] gyp ERR! configure error 
[INFO] gyp ERR! stack Error: Can't find Python executable "python", you can set 
the PYTHON env variable.
[INFO] gyp ERR! stack     at PythonFinder.failNoPython 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ass/node_modules/node-gyp/lib/configure.js:484:19)
[INFO] gyp ERR! stack     at PythonFinder.<anonymous> 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ass/node_modules/node-gyp/lib/configure.js:406:16)
[INFO] gyp ERR! stack     at F 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:68:16)
[INFO] gyp ERR! stack     at E 
(/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:80:29)
[INFO] gyp ERR! stack     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/which/which.js:89:16
[INFO] gyp ERR! stack     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/index.js:42:5
[INFO] gyp ERR! stack     at 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/isexe/mode.js:8:5
[INFO] gyp ERR! stack     at FSReqCallback.oncomplete (fs.js:168:21)
[INFO] gyp ERR! System Linux 6.6.32-linuxkit
[INFO] gyp ERR! command 
"/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node/node"
 
"/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ass/node_modules/node-gyp/bin/node-gyp.js"
 "rebuild" "--verbose" "--libsass_ext=" "--libsass_cflags=" 
"--libsass_ldflags=" "--libsass_library="
[INFO] gyp ERR! cwd 
/build/source/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-ui/target/webapp/node_modules/node-sass
[INFO] gyp ERR! node -v v12.22.1
[INFO] gyp ERR! node-gyp -v v3.8.0
[INFO] gyp ERR! not ok 
[INFO] Build failed with error code: 1
[INFO] ------------------------------------------------------------------------
[INFO] Reactor Summary for Apache Hadoop YARN UI 3.4.1:
[INFO] 
[INFO] Apache Hadoop YARN UI .............................. FAILURE [ 29.848 
s]{noformat}



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

---------------------------------------------------------------------
To unsubscribe, e-mail: yarn-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: yarn-dev-h...@hadoop.apache.org

Reply via email to